A compass rose is a symbol on a map that shows the cardinal directions: north, south, east, and west. It usually looks like a star and helps us understand which way we are facing. When we use a compass rose, we can figure out if we are going north toward the mountains or south toward the ocean. This tool is essential for anyone who wants to explore or navigate using a map!
